The island’s women’s team proved it’s not the size of the flag but the team playing for it that matters as they won their second game at the Island Games.
Wayne Lisy’s side beat Froya 6-0.
Holly Sumner scored the opener after just 7 minutes to set the Manx side on their way to three points.
With Froya reduced to 10 players for a handball, despite a missed penalty, the Manx women were quick to press home the advantage.
Goals from Chloe Teare, Milly Dawson and a Pippa Wllis penalty made it a 4-0 lead at the break.
Despite missing an early second half penalty, the Manx side continued to dominate and Holly Stephen made it five with 70 minutes on the clock.
Lisa Costain added a sixth late on in the 85th minute to put the cherry on the cake.
